Лабораторная работа №5 (на С++) по дисциплине "Теория информации"
Состав работы
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Работа представляет собой rar архив с файлами (распаковать онлайн), которые открываются в программах:
- Программа для просмотра текстовых файлов
- Microsoft Word
Описание
Почти оптимальное кодирование
Цель работы: Изучение метода почти оптимального кодирования Шеннона.
Среда программирования: любая с С-подобным языком программирования.
Результат: программа, тестовые примеры, отчет.
1. Запрограммировать процедуру двоичного кодирования текстового файла методом Шеннона. Текстовые файлы использовать те же, что и в лабораторной работе №1-4. Для художественных текстов (русский или английский языки) предполагается, что строчные и заглавные символы не отличаются, знаки препинания объединены в один символ, к алфавиту добавлен пробел, для русских текстов буквы «е» и «ё», «ь» и «ъ» совпадают.
2. Проверить, что полученный код является префиксным.
3. После кодирования текстового файла вычислить оценки энтропии выходной последовательности, используя частоты отдельных символов, пар символов и троек символов.
4. Заполнить таблицу и проанализировать полученные результаты.
Цель работы: Изучение метода почти оптимального кодирования Шеннона.
Среда программирования: любая с С-подобным языком программирования.
Результат: программа, тестовые примеры, отчет.
1. Запрограммировать процедуру двоичного кодирования текстового файла методом Шеннона. Текстовые файлы использовать те же, что и в лабораторной работе №1-4. Для художественных текстов (русский или английский языки) предполагается, что строчные и заглавные символы не отличаются, знаки препинания объединены в один символ, к алфавиту добавлен пробел, для русских текстов буквы «е» и «ё», «ь» и «ъ» совпадают.
2. Проверить, что полученный код является префиксным.
3. После кодирования текстового файла вычислить оценки энтропии выходной последовательности, используя частоты отдельных символов, пар символов и троек символов.
4. Заполнить таблицу и проанализировать полученные результаты.
Дополнительная информация
Работа зачтена в 2016 году без замечаний.
Могу сделать по этому предмету контрольную и экзамен.
Я работаю решающим в интернете.
Моя почта: dy1279@mail.ru
Могу сделать по этому предмету контрольную и экзамен.
Я работаю решающим в интернете.
Моя почта: dy1279@mail.ru
Похожие материалы
Лабораторная работа № 5 по дисциплине: Теория информации
Cherebas
: 10 декабря 2012
Изучить теоретический материал гл. 8
Закодировать словарным кодом с использованием адаптивного словаря текст на английском языке, текст на русском языке и текст программы на языке С (использовать файлы не менее 1 Кб).
Вычислить коэффициенты сжатия данных как процентное отношение длины закодированного файла к длине исходного файла, построить таблицу вида:
Проанализировать полученные результаты. Сравнить полученные результаты с результатами предыдущих лабораторных работ.
99 руб.
Лабораторная работа №5 по дисциплине: Теория информации. Для всех вариантов
IT-STUDHELP
: 21 июня 2017
Лабораторная работа 5
Почти оптимальное кодирование
Цель работы: Изучение метода почти оптимального кодирования Шеннона.
Среда программирования: любая с С-подобным языком программирования.
Результат: программа, тестовые примеры, отчет.
1. Запрограммировать процедуру двоичного кодирования текстового файла методом Шеннона. Текстовые файлы использовать те же, что и в лабораторной работе №1-4. Для художественных текстов (русский или английский языки) предполагается, что строчные и заглавные символы
20 руб.
Лабораторная работа №5 по дисциплине: Теория информации. Вариант №02
Jack
: 4 сентября 2014
Лабораторная работа №5
1. Задание
1. Закодировать словарным кодом с использованием адаптивного словаря текст на английском языке, текст на русском языке и текст программы на языке С (использовать файлы не менее 1 Кб).
2. Вычислить коэффициенты сжатия данных как процентное отношение длины закодированного файла к длине исходного файла, построить таблицу вида:
Размер исходного
файла Коэффициент сжатия данных
Текст на английском языке Текст на русском языке Текст программы на языке С
3. Проанализир
100 руб.
Лабораторная работа №5 по дисциплине: «Теория информации». Вариант №7
kiana
: 1 февраля 2014
Постановка задачи
Закодировать словарным кодом с использованием адаптивного словаря текст на английском языке, текст на русском языке и текст программы на языке С (использовать файлы не менее 1 Кб).
Вычислить коэффициенты сжатия данных как процентное отношение длины закодированного файла к длине исходного файла, построить таблицу вида:
Размер исходного
файла Коэффициент сжатия данных
Текст на английском языке Текст на русском языке Текст программы на языке С
Проанализировать полученные
50 руб.
Лабораторная работа №5 по дисциплине: Теория информации. Вариант №9
Amor
: 29 октября 2013
Задание на лабораторную работу № 5 «Словарные коды»
Порядок выполнения работы
1. Изучить теоретический материал гл. 8
2. Закодировать словарным кодом с использованием адаптивного словаря текст на английском языке, текст на русском языке и текст программы на языке С (использовать файлы не менее 1 Кб).
3. Вычислить коэффициенты сжатия данных как процентное отношение длины закодированного файла к длине исходного файла, построить таблицу вида:
Размер исходного файла Коэффициент сжатия данных
50 руб.
Лабораторная работа № 5 по дисциплине: Теория информации. Тема: Словарные коды
Nicola90
: 16 декабря 2012
Изучить теоретический материал гл. 8
Закодировать словарным кодом с использованием адаптивного словаря текст на английском языке, текст на русском языке и текст программы на языке С (использовать файлы не менее 1 Кб).
Вычислить коэффициенты сжатия данных как процентное отношение длины закодированного файла к длине исходного файла, построить таблицу вида
120 руб.
Лабораторная работа № 5 по дисциплине: Теория информации. Тема: Словарные коды
GTV8
: 9 сентября 2012
Теория информации, Лабораторная работа №5 СибГУТИ, год сдачи 2012, преподаватель Мачикина Елена Павловна
----------------------------------
Лабораторная работа №5
----------------------------------
1. Изучить теоретический материал гл. 8
2. Закодировать словарным кодом с использованием адаптивного словаря текст на английском языке, текст на русском языке и текст программы на языке С (использовать файлы не менее 1 Кб).
3. Вычислить коэффициенты сжатия данных как процентное отношение длины зако
1000 руб.
Лабораторные работы №№1-5 по дисциплине: Теория информации
Amor
: 29 октября 2013
Лабораторная работа № 1 «Вычисление энтропии Шеннона».
1. Реализовать процедуру вычисления энтропии для текстового файла на английском языке. В процедуре необходимо подсчитывать частоты появления символов (прописные и заглавные буквы не отличаются, знаки препинания рассматриваются как один символ, пробел является самостоятельным символом), которые можно использовать как оценки вероятностей появления символов. Затем вычислить величину энтропии Шеннона. Точность вычисления -- 4 знака после запятой
200 руб.
Другие работы
Ускорители схватывания и твердения в технологии бетонов.
elementpio
: 18 октября 2011
Ускорителей схватывания и твердения цементных композиций много. Существует несколько их классификаций, основанных на механизме действия на гидратацию цемента. Если же провести разделение по узко химической принадлежности, то к ускорителям можно отнести следующие вещества (курсивом выделены гостированные ускорители):
Углекислые соли
Калий углекислый (поташ) – K2CO3
Натрий углекислый (сода) - Na2CO3
Сернокислые соли
Натрий сернокислый – Na2SO4
Натрий тиосульфат + натрий роданид (Na2S2O3 + NaCNS)
Г
11 руб.
Практика действий режимов в интерпретации представителей интеллектуальной элиты Ближнего Востока
Qiwir
: 12 января 2014
Практика действий режимов в интерпретации представителей интеллектуальной элиты Ближнего Востока
демократизация арабский восток
Говоря о сегодняшней ситуации в сфере демократизации в странах Северной Африки М.А. Аль-Хармаси, в частности, подчеркивал: «Ни одно из правительств Магриба от Рабата до Триполи не смогло добиться решения постоянно бросавших им вызовы задач: большей экономической эффективности, с одной стороны, и политического обновления, c другой.
Ситуация стала еще более сложной, когда
5 руб.
Относительные и средние величины, оценка их достоверности. Вариационные ряды. Методика анализа динамического ряда. Стандартизация
alfFRED
: 2 ноября 2013
1. Рассчитать интенсивные, экстенсивные показатели, показатели соотношения и наглядности. По полученным данным сделать соответствующие выводы
Численность города Н - 157 000 человек. В 2007 году зарегистрировано 490 случаев инфекционных заболеваний, в том числе воздушно-капельных инфекций - 230, острых кишечных инфекций - 210. прочих - 50. Всего в городе 30 инфекционных коек и 3 врача инфекциониста. Заболеваемость за предыдущие 3 года была следующей: 2004г.- 392,5 на 100 000 населения; 2005г. -3
10 руб.
Чертеж - Динамометр-люфтомер модели К402
Рики-Тики-Та
: 15 июля 2018
Чертеж - Динамометр-люфтомер модели К402 + спецификация
11 руб.